pretty sure all 6.4s are the same motor. they are 08-10 for what thats worth. They don't all have problems but its a crapshoot. If you do have motor problems youve gotta pull the body off the frame. 6.7 came out in 2011. The duramax also changed in the 2011 year model (when they released the denali hd). New and old are both 6.6 but the lml (2011-2015i) is a better motor per the diesel blow hards. Ive seen a few 6.0s on cars.com and ebay but I don't know if you're willing to go that route.
